Pros

1. A healthy work-life balance, emphasizing DEI, mental health, and collaboration. 2. Although there is a rigid hierarchy, managers do not exploit their power, creating the feeling of equality. 3. Interesting initiatives for data scientists, working on state-of-the-art AI with lots of high-quality data.

Cons

1. A massive bureaucratic machine that slows down collaboration between teams. 2. As one of the few companies that have survived since the 19th century, Elsevier has a robust and established business model. Although this provides unprecedented stability, with many of my co-workers being lifelong Elsevier employees (20 to 40-year careers), this makes the company pretty rigid regarding innovation. Single-digit percentages of POCs get to production, with hundreds of data scientists working on new ideas.
